在數字化浪潮席卷全球的今天,密碼安全成為了不可忽視的重要議題。網絡安全領域的權威機構Hive Systems最近發布了一項引人深思的研究,該研究揭示了當前技術背景下,各類密碼被破解所需的時間。
據悉,Hive Systems利用單張RTX 5090顯卡進行測試,發現僅需短短3小時,就能成功破解一個由8位純數字組成的密碼。而當12張這樣的顯卡協同工作時,這一時間更是驚人地縮短到了15分鐘。這一數據無疑為那些仍在使用簡單數字密碼的用戶敲響了警鐘。
然而,隨著密碼復雜度的提升,破解難度也呈現出幾何級的增長。以8位小寫字母組成的密碼為例,單張RTX 5090顯卡需要長達8個月的時間才能破解,即便是12張顯卡并行工作,也需要整整3周的時間。這一發現表明,增加密碼的字符種類和復雜度是提升安全性的有效途徑。
更進一步的研究顯示,當密碼中包含數字、大寫字母和小寫字母時,其安全性得到了顯著提升。即便是在12張RTX 5090顯卡的強力攻擊下,也需要62年的時間才能破解。而如果密碼中還加入了符號,那么破解時間更是延長至了驚人的164年。這無疑為追求極致安全的用戶提供了有力的理論支持。
Hive Systems的研究還強調了密碼長度對安全性的重要影響。以一個由18個字符組成的純數字密碼為例,即便是12張RTX 5090顯卡也需要28.4萬年的時間才能破解。這一數據無疑再次證明了“長度決定安全”的密碼學原理。
值得注意的是,Hive Systems在報告中提到的破解時間數據是基于最壞情況的假設得出的,即攻擊者的破解軟件需要嘗試所有可能的值,并且用戶的密碼恰好是最后一個被猜中的。在實際應用中,由于用戶行為模式、密碼使用習慣等因素的影響,破解時間可能會有所縮短。
針對這一現狀,美國國家標準與技術研究院(NIST)也給出了專業建議。NIST建議用戶設置的密碼最小字符數為15個,因為即便是使用當前最先進的硬件和技術手段,破解一個15個字符的密碼所需的時間也將遠遠超出人類的壽命。這一建議為用戶在保障密碼安全方面提供了明確的方向。